**Ticket: Reindex vault locked — nightly search reindex stalled.** Flagging for the weekly sync: the Searchline nightly reindex has been skipping since Tuesday because the index-signing vault on the Dunmore node locked itself after three failed auto-unlock attempts. Root cause looks like the rotation job wrote the new key before updating the unlock hook. Manual unlock works fine; I did it last night. If it locks again before the fix lands, use the recovery phrase below.

unlock words, hahip-baduf: holwyn-istath-julvan

Welcome to the support rotation. One tool you'll touch weekly is stringscrape, the script that extracts translation strings from the Lanternwell client and pushes them to our localization queue. You don't need to understand the parser; you just run it when a customer reports a missing translation and attach the output to the ticket. The script authenticates against the locale service using the key below.

gateway credential: kto23_LX9A4ys6i4nzHtpOLNLodKK

TURN-208: Gatevale turnstile counters at the Merrow Field pilot double-count when a rotation reverses mid-cycle. Attendance totals drift roughly 2% high per event. The debounce window fix is implemented, reviewed by Ilsa, and soak-tested across two simulated match days without drift. Ready for your cut; the candidate build is identified below.

trace token, tagag-tafog: htk6_5ed18c

Subject: Quickstore 4.2 — bloom filter now fronts the KV layer

Plugin authors: starting with this release, Quickstore places a bloom filter ahead of the key-value store. Negative lookups return faster; false positives fall through safely. No API changes are required on your side. Verify your plugin against the staging build referenced below.

session token of fahif-tadup = htk3_9c7

Step 6 — Deep-link routing. Before cutting the Wayfolk mobile release, confirm the link-router service resolves app links for both staging and prod schemes. The router won't start without its signing credential, so pop open the env file on the router host and add the following line:

secret setting of kajef-yahag: RELAY_SECRET20=f7a001bb8ebd9be883d6